MNP Class 4
Here the modems improve on class 3 by adapting the size of the packets exchanged to suit the cleanliness of the line and the burstiness of the traffic. The cleaner the line, the bigger the packets. The protocol efficiency is about 120% on a clean line. A 2400 BPS modem will realise a throughput of about 2900 BPS. Tymnet/BIX uses MNP level 4. MNP-4 is the alternate error correcting protocol in CCITT V.42.
